Mott & Chace Sotheby’s International Realty Announces Significant Sale on the East Side of Providence by Liz Andrews

Mott & Chace Sotheby’s International Realty is pleased to announce the sale of 66 Williams Street for $4,600,000. The seller was represented by Liz Andrews, Sales Associate of Mott & Chace Sotheby’s International Realty. Lorraine Bandoni of Crossroads Real Estate Group represented the buyer.

The sale of 66 Williams Street is the highest ever recorded residential transaction in Providence, according to data available from Rhode Island Statewide Multiple Listing Service.

The estate offers over 11,000 square feet of gracious living on three impressively finished levels. Originally built in 1810 by prominent businessman John Corliss, the home was purchased in 1812 by wealthy merchant Edward Carrington upon his return from China where he served as American Consul. The estate remained in the family for three generations.

Situated on almost an acre of beautifully manicured grounds atop Providence’s historic College Hill, the home features a dramatic entrance with a curved staircase, an exquisite dining room, a significant two-story office, a chef’s kitchen and a large master suite. Additionally, the original horse stables remain connected to the residence. With intact stalls and radiant heated floors, the barn has been restored into an entertaining sanctuary complete with a caterer’s kitchen.
